CVE-2021-42137 is a medium-severity vulnerability rated 5.3/10 on the CVSS scale. An issue was discovered in Zammad before 5.0.1. In some cases, there is improper enforcement of the privilege requirement for viewing a list of tickets that shows title, state, etc.. EPSS estimates a 0.81% chance of exploitation in the next 30 days.
